3️⃣ 📈 Recent Team Form and Key Players to Watch
Everton:
- Recent Form: W-W-L-L-L-D (Wins against Tottenham and Brighton, but inconsistent form overall)
- Key Players: Iliman Ndiaye (scored the winner vs Brighton, in good form), Jarrad Branthwaite (key defender).
- Injury Concerns: Dominic Calvert-Lewin (hamstring, likely out), Orel Mangala (ACL, out for season), Armando Broja (ankle, out), Youssef Chermiti (thigh, out), Dwight McNeil (knee, out), Seamus Coleman (calf, out). Tim Iroegbunam is returning from injury but not fully fit. Beto is the only fit senior striker.
